About the film: Noted Italian filmmaker Michelangelo Antonioni made his English-language debut with this existential story of a detached fashion photographer who unknowingly captures a death while taking pictures in a park. Set in London during the swinging ‘60s, BLOW-UP is a haunting psychological mystery that boasts a beautiful color palette and a jazzy score courtesy of Herbie Hancock.
